I do live in a state where medical marihuana (their spelling. not mine) is legal; and recreational is on the November ballot.

That being noted:

  • I am a legal card carrying MMMP card holder and grower in my state.
  • I have an auto-immune disease which causes major episodes of vertigo, nausea and, more or less, mental discombobulation in my daily life

I grow and consume for medical reasons, not recreational use. Without the usage of marijuana, my life would be worthless. It helps me get through an episode of vertigo; which occurs 3-4 days per week. It helps ease me through the nausea. It helps me maintain a somewhat livable life. It helps me sleep off the vertigo and so many other symptoms that can make my daily life miserable. CBD oil is the same.

I feel an episode starting, I will take some CBD oil or hit my THC e-cig... and I am relaxing. The anxiety of knowing what will be happening during the oncoming episode is starting to drift away.

But as for the recreational reasons to make this legal:

  • Just imagine ALL the people that can be put to work... from growers to trimmers, botanists and farmers. From the truck drivers and harvesters to the sales' staff. Unemployment would take a huge drop. People of all levels of education could benefit from employment. Plus... let's not forget the state revenue that could be taken in. Excise tax on the sales could pay for rebuilding roads and other infrastructure... school systems could get some much needed revenue for supplies... sales tax could be lowered to make the cost of living more attainable for some.
  • Opioid addiction- My husband is one of the sad cases of doctors writing prescriptions for controlled, Schedule 1 opioids. For over 5 years he has been taking all sorts of controlled substances for chronic pain (even after having neck and back surgeries). The doctors think NOTHING of writing out a script for percocet, oxycontin or morphine when marijuana is a much better alternative. Marijuana doesn't infiltrate your body and add acetaminophen; ruining your kidneys or building up in your system and liver- which can cause organ failure.

I am 100% advocating for marijuana to be made legal- at both the state and federal levels.
